Specialty Feedstock can be used for making anthraquinone dyes, complex tan liquor, oil paint, wood aseptic, printing ink, carbon black, latex filling etc.
Controlled mesophase behavior for optimized carbon structure formation, Ultra-low ash and metallic impurities, High carbon yield with consistent quality, Enhanced reactor stability and process efficiency & Reliable performance in high-temperature carbonization processes.
Electric Vehicle (EV) battery materials, Semiconductor-grade carbon components, Advanced energy storage systems, High-performance rubber and tire compounds, Conductive polymers and EMI shielding materials & aerospace and advanced electronic applications
Specialty Feedstock is marketed in liquid tankers and drums.
| S.No | Test Parameters | UOM | Testing Method |
Specification |
|---|---|---|---|---|
| 1 | Specific Gravity at 15.56 C | Deg C | ASTMD-1298-2B | 1.101 to 1.121 |
| 2 | BMCI (Gross) | Calculation | In House | 135 Min |
| 3 | Toluene Insoluble (TI) | % | ASTMD-312 | 1 Max |
| 4 | Viscosity @99 deg c | CP | ASTMD-88 | 50 Max |
| 5 | Ash | % | ASTM D-482 | 0.03 Max |
| 6 | Flash Point | Deg C | ASTMD-93 A | 120 min |
| 7 | Moisture | % | IS-218 | 0.50 max |
| 8 | Na | PPM | ASTM | 10 max |
| 9 | K+ | PPM | ASTM | 2 max |
| 10 | pH | In House | 6 min | |
| 11 | Carbon | % | ASTM D5291 | 88 Min |
| 12 | Sulphur | % | ASTMD7679 | 0.30 max |
| 13 | Asphaltene | % | ASTM D6560 | 5 Max |
